如何从链码调用其他库?

时间:2017-05-11 05:01:10

标签: hyperledger-composer

https://hyperledger.github.io/composer/reference/MeetTheModules.html中说:

  

composer-client和composer-admin是为应用程序提供API的两个模块。 node.js应用程序应该只使用来自这些模块的API。如果还有其他需要的API,请与我们联系。

如果我的链代码需要使用AWS Node SDK来调用AWS服务,那么这是我们应该联系开发团队的场景吗?我是node.js btw的新手,如果这是一个显而易见的问题,请道歉。

1 个答案:

答案 0 :(得分:1)

chaincode(或Composer术语中的事务处理器函数)在用Go编写的JavaScript虚拟机中执行,而不是Node.js.目前无法从事务处理器函数导入Node.js模块或调用外部服务。 我们非常有兴趣为Fabric添加Node.js链代码支持,这是我们计划开始的工作。